G Adventures is encouraging Australian travel professionals to let their imaginations run wild for its interactive online travel project called 'Create Your Own Adventure.'
Travel industry professionals who wish to participate in the 'Create Your Own Adventure' initiative are invited to submit an itinerary for the tour of their dreams, virtually anywhere in the world, virtually any way they want.
The nine-person panel includes Lonely Planet co-founder Tony Wheeler, filmmaker and adventurer Céline Cousteau, Zappos CEO Tony Hsieh, National Geographic Adventure editor-in-chief John Rasmus, explorer and BBC presenter Benedict Allen, Outside executive editor Mike Roberts, adventurer Alastair Humphreys, polar explorer and author Tom Avery, and G Adventures' Founder Bruce Poon Tip.
"Given it's the 20th anniversary of G Adventures changing people's lives, we thought it was only fair that those in the local travel industry - who have supported us so greatly throughout the years - should be able to build their own dream itinerary for everyone to experience," says Bruce Poon Tip.
"Create Your Own Adventure is a unique travel initiative that reflects of one of our company's core values.
"We can't think of a better way to create happiness and community the world over, than by unlocking the creativity of so many people who live and breathe the travel industry."
Travel industry professionals can log on to: www.createyourownadventure.com and create their dream itinerary by selecting up to three countries to include in their trip, a name and duration for the tour and a selection of highlights and activities.
They will then be asked to describe why their tour is a fantastic adventure like none other. Deadline for submission is March 31, 2010.
The grand prize winner, which will be determined through public online polling and input from the panel, will be featured in the G Adventures worldwide 2011 brochure.
The creator of the winning tour will also get to experience their once in a lifetime trip along with two lucky friends.
They will also get to enjoy a prize of package worth over $15,000, which includes electronics, clothing, footwear and travel guides. The total prize pool is worth over $40,000.
In addition, five other participants will be selected through a draw to join the grand prize winner and guests on this inaugural trip. The winner will be announced in May 25, 2010.
